Article: Makeover on tap for Robert F. Kennedy Medical Center. (Health Care).

LESS than two months after taking over operations of Robert F. Kennedy Medical Center, the Daughters of Charity Health System is signaling that it's not afraid to take on Tenet Healthcare Corp.

Officials of the 274-bed Hawthorne hospital announced that they're moving ahead with a $34 million expansion of the aging facility, parts of which faced being taken out of service under the state's hospital earthquake safety law.

The expansion will involve construction of a new patient tower that will include new operating rooms, new intensive care units, 79 patient beds and other units, including obstetrics.
